Binary search is an algorithm used to find an element i.e., key in a sorted array. Binary algorithm works as below . Let us say that array is ‘arr’. Sort the array in ascending or descending order. Initialize low = 0 and high = n-1 (n = number of elements) and calculate middle as middle = low + (high-low)/2.

WebApr 19, 2024 · Binary Definition. In computer science and mathematics, binary is a system where numbers and values are expressed 0 or 1. Binary is base-2, meaning that it only uses two digits or bits. For computers, 1 is true or "on", and 0 is false or "off".
